Common Failures of MG 10251993 Shock absorber spring for MG6

  • Spring Fatigue: The shock absorber spring with OE number 10251993 in MG6 often suffers from fatigue, losing its elasticity over time. This leads to a harsher ride.
  • Corrosion Damage: Due to environmental exposure, the shock absorber spring of MG6 can corrode. Corroded springs may break and cause handling issues.

Maintenance Tips of MG 10251993 Shock absorber spring for MG6

  • Before installing the MG6 shock absorber spring (OE# 10251993), thoroughly clean the mounting area to prevent debris from causing premature wear.
  • Use a reliable spring compressor to safely handle the MG shock absorber spring. This tool helps avoid sudden release of tension during installation.
  • Check the spring's dimensions and specifications to ensure it matches the requirements of the MG6. A proper fit is crucial for optimal performance.
  • Apply a thin layer of lubricant to the contact points of the shock absorber spring and related components. This reduces friction and noise during operation.
  • Inspect the spring for any signs of damage or corrosion. A damaged spring may compromise the safety and handling of the MG6.
Warning: Always wear appropriate safety gear when working with the MG shock absorber spring. Incorrect handling can lead to serious injury due to the high tension stored in the spring.
